Food Safety Report: McDonald's, Alamo Plaza, San Antonio, TX, USA.

7 years ago reported by user-zzwhp328 business

McDonald's, Alamo Plaza, San Antonio, TX, USA

101 Alamo Plaza, San Antonio, 78205 Texas, United States

My wife and I had the M.c Rib sandwich this past Sunday. With thin a few hours we felt nausea and then.progressed into vomiting and diareahea. We had this condition for 48 hours. We were on vacation and missed our flight home to Iowa be a cause of this. . | Symptoms: Diarrhea, Nausea, Vomiting
